Irr function python
WebIRR function. I need to manually write out (no using the functions python already has for this) a function that calculates the IRR for a given set of cash flows. I have already created a function that calculates the net present value of a list of cash flows, and was advised to use that function within my IRR function as well as a while loop. WebI've worked with calculating an IRR for a couple of weeks now. I have implemented 5 different methods and have come to the conclusion that Halley's Method is the most efficient (in my case, using Python) thus far. Brent's method works pretty well too!
Irr function python
Did you know?
WebFeb 18, 2024 · numpy.irr(values) [source] ¶. Return the Internal Rate of Return (IRR). This is the “average” periodically compounded rate of return that gives a net present value of 0.0; … WebA few financial functions for quick analysis of an investment opportunity and a series of associated cashflows. As a module, it currently provides straightforward and easy to …
WebMar 13, 2024 · To make a decision, the IRR for investing in the new equipment is calculated below. Excel was used to calculate the IRR of 13%, using the function, = IRR (). From a financial standpoint, the company … WebApr 26, 2024 · To calculate the IRR for each dataframe I made these functions: def npv (irr, cfs, yrs): return np.sum (cfs / ( (1. + irr) ** yrs)) def irr (cfs, yrs, x0) return np.asscalar (fsolve (npv, x0=x0, args= (cfs, yrs))) So in order to calculate the IRR for each dataframe in my list I …
WebCode that imports the function names like this from numpy import npv, irr requires only that the import be changed to from numpy_financial import npv, irr For code that uses the numpy namespace like this import numpy as np x = np.array ( [-250000, 100000, 150000, 200000, 250000, 300000]) r = np.irr (x)
WebOct 10, 2024 · Internal Rate of Return (Unequal Timing) in Python 10 Oct 2024 Setup from bs4 import BeautifulSoup import pandas as pd import numpy as np import …
WebAug 19, 2024 · The irr() function is used to get the Internal Rate of Return (IRR). This is the "average" periodically compounded rate of return that gives a net present value of 0.0; for … time to decide who\\u0027s in or out crosswordWebThe IRR function syntax has the following arguments: Values Required. An array or a reference to cells that contain numbers for which you want to calculate the internal rate of return. Values must contain at least one positive value and one negative value to calculate the internal rate of return. paris to verdun by trainWebSep 18, 2012 · IRR (Internal Rate of Return) is the most widely used financial indicator while assessing return on an investment or a project. It is defined as the discount rate which makes the net present value of the cash flows from the investment equal to zero. time today in united statesWebJun 10, 2024 · Return the Internal Rate of Return (IRR). This is the “average” periodically compounded rate of return that gives a net present value of 0.0; for a more complete explanation, see Notes below. Notes The IRR is perhaps best understood through an example (illustrated using np.irr in the Examples section below). paristown entertainment districtWebMar 11, 2024 · Your Investment’s Internal Rate of Return Using Binary Search Algorithm by Francis Adrian Viernes Python in Plain English 500 Apologies, but something went wrong on our end. Refresh the page, check Medium ’s site status, or find something interesting to read. Francis Adrian Viernes 404 Followers paris tower soap dispenser gold colorWebIRR stands for the Internal Rate of Return. The irr ( ) method provided by NumPy helps in making investment decisions. This is a financial function that helps the user to compute … paris tower nameWebAug 5, 2024 · IRR equals to – Parameters : values : [array-like] Input cash flows per time period. net “deposits” are negative and net “withdrawals” are positive finance_rate : … time to days